Abstract

Based on the Gini Index of educational inequality, China's educational development level is progressing steadily and remarkable achievements have been made. However, the gap between urban and rural education has been expanding, and the gap between urban and rural education development has become the most important factor affecting the educational inequality of the country and provinces. Based on the consideration of history, gender, family income and other factors as well as case analysis, this paper proposes the following solutions: (1) Make full use of the Internet and other information resources in the teaching process; (2) Rural children can conduct reasonable exchanges and visits to urban children; (3) Matching urban and rural assistance; (4) Increase the attraction of voluntary education. Although nowadays, rural education and higher education in China become more and more popular but education inequality exists in detail. Moreover, solutions should be put into effect multiaspectly. In the process of urban and rural development, the study of educational inequality is conducive to solving the mental health problems of rural students and urban students. It can also improve the ability of rural students and urban students to live independently outside and adapt to the environment, so as to reduce the living economic cost as much as possible and enlarge the social benefits at the same time.
